Recruiting Update (~15:00 - ~30:00) Wide Receiver: Strong confidence in Jameron Simmons (top-ranked WR) trending to Clemson; also in mix for Tay Walden. Pairing with Trey Windley would be solid. Safety: Focus shifting to Jarrell Chandler (versatile, fits Tom Allen scheme) after others trend elsewhere. Running Back: Andrew Beard to Florida; Gary Walker heavily trending to Clemson. Staff (CJ Spiller) would be happy with him. Tight End: Official visit pushes for Carter Blackwell (confirmed) and Mason Hall. Defensive End: Monitoring Caleb Spivey, Elijah Cox, Jaquan Rogers; recent offers out. Overall tone: Not doom-and-gloom despite recent misses; focus on quality over quantity and hot irons in the fire. 3. College GameDay Announcement & LSU Preview (~30:00 - ~1:00:00) Official: College GameDay at LSU ("Fake Death Valley") for Clemson Week 1. Not a surprise — best Week 1 game. Clemson ~11.5-point underdog; hosts expect double-digit spread. Optimism for upset potential due to: Both teams have massive unknowns (new schemes, transfers, QB health for LSU's Sam Leavitt). Clemson as motivated underdog (Dabo loves this narrative). LSU's portal-heavy roster may not gel immediately (reference to past Week 1 upsets like Alabama-FSU). Clemson advantages discussed: New Chad Morris offense (unknown tape), skill talent mismatches possible (TEs, RBs), athleticism improvements on defense. 4. 2026 Schedule Defense Rankings (~1:00:00 - ~1:52:00) Draft-style ranking of Power 4 defenses Clemson will face (best to worst). Key Segments & Takeaways 1. 2027 Recruiting Struggles Recent losses: 4 TE Jackson Dollar → Georgia 4 OT Elijah Hutchison → Florida RB Andrew Beard sets commitment date for May 9 (finalists: Clemson, Florida, Tennessee, Georgia; momentum leans away from Clemson) Clemson is 0-4 vs. Florida on top 2027 targets this cycle. Bright spots: Still strong on RB Gary Walker (official visit expected); OL depth from prior class helps but creates logjam concerns. Broader context: Post 7-6 season effects, negative recruiting, NIL disparities, and Florida’s new staff under John Sumrall making an impact. Hosts’ view: Need to dig deeper on the board and use the transfer portal; still time before major official visit weekends (late May & mid-June). 2. Dabo Sweeney on Greg McElroy Podcast Dabo was very candid about Clemson’s NIL financial limitations and recruiting philosophy (won’t overpay high school kids above current roster values, e.g., Sammy Brown example). Drew parallels to his early tenure turnaround. Hosts’ reaction: Appreciate the honesty, but skeptical Clemson can compete nationally without adjusting the model. Rev-share (86% participation) hasn’t replaced NIL effectively. Coaching staff changes and talent acquisition remain critical issues. 3. Program Direction & Future Outlook Acknowledgment of downward trajectory since ~2020 and the 7-6 season. Strong praise for Dabo’s overall impact on the university (facilities, enrollment, visibility, donations). Realistic assessment: Clemson can return to 9–10 wins and ACC contention, but national championship contention requires changes in NIL strategy, coaching execution, and roster building.
